PEP是Python Enhancement Proposal的缩写,它是一系列
▥Python
𝄐 0
python中pep,pythonpenup,python peak,python pecan,python peewee,python的pipe
PEP是Python Enhancement Proposal的缩写,它是一系列文档,描述了新功能、语言增强和标准库修改的提案。这些提案经过社区的讨论和审查后,可能会被纳入Python的未来版本中。
以下是几个Python相关的PEP及其简要描述:
1. PEP 8 -- Style Guide for Python Code
这份文档规定了Python代码的编写风格,涵盖了命名约定、代码布局、注释等方面,并旨在使Python代码更具可读性和一致性。例如,在PEP 8中推荐使用下划线分隔的函数和变量名(如my_variable),而不是驼峰式(如myVariable)。
2. PEP 20 -- The Zen of Python
这份文档是Python社区的价值观和设计原则的总结。其中包含了20个原则,如“美胜于丑”、“简洁胜于复杂”,并以一种诗歌般的方式表述出来。例如,“优美胜于丑陋”意味着Python鼓励编写易于阅读和理解的代码。
3. PEP 257 -- Docstring Conventions
这份文档规定了Python docstring(函数和模块的文档字符串)的编写规范,以确保它们易于阅读和自动化处理。例如,PEP 257建议为所有模块、函数和方法编写docstring,并提供了示例代码。
4. PEP 484 -- Type Hints
这份文档引入了类型提示的概念,即在Python代码中显式地指定变量、函数参数和返回值的数据类型。这有助于提高代码的可读性、调试和维护性。例如,以下是一个使用类型提示的Python函数:
def greeting(name: str) -> str:
return f"Hello, {name}!"
在这个例子中,变量name的类型被指定为str(字符串),而函数的返回类型也被指定为str。
PEP是Python Enhancement Proposal的缩写,它是一系列文档,描述了新功能、语言增强和标准库修改的提案。这些提案经过社区的讨论和审查后,可能会被纳入Python的未来版本中。
以下是几个Python相关的PEP及其简要描述:
1. PEP 8 -- Style Guide for Python Code
这份文档规定了Python代码的编写风格,涵盖了命名约定、代码布局、注释等方面,并旨在使Python代码更具可读性和一致性。例如,在PEP 8中推荐使用下划线分隔的函数和变量名(如my_variable),而不是驼峰式(如myVariable)。
2. PEP 20 -- The Zen of Python
这份文档是Python社区的价值观和设计原则的总结。其中包含了20个原则,如“美胜于丑”、“简洁胜于复杂”,并以一种诗歌般的方式表述出来。例如,“优美胜于丑陋”意味着Python鼓励编写易于阅读和理解的代码。
3. PEP 257 -- Docstring Conventions
这份文档规定了Python docstring(函数和模块的文档字符串)的编写规范,以确保它们易于阅读和自动化处理。例如,PEP 257建议为所有模块、函数和方法编写docstring,并提供了示例代码。
4. PEP 484 -- Type Hints
这份文档引入了类型提示的概念,即在Python代码中显式地指定变量、函数参数和返回值的数据类型。这有助于提高代码的可读性、调试和维护性。例如,以下是一个使用类型提示的Python函数:
def greeting(name: str) -> str:
return f"Hello, {name}!"
在这个例子中,变量name的类型被指定为str(字符串),而函数的返回类型也被指定为str。
本文地址:
/show-276484.html
版权声明:除非特别标注原创,其它均来自互联网,转载时请以链接形式注明文章出处。